The Linux CAC Reader stack is based on a set of middleware called PCSC (Personal Computer Smart Card), written by the MUSCLE (Movement for the Use of Smart Cards in a Linux Environment) project.Įnter this into Terminal and execute: sudo apt install libpcsclite1 pcscd pcsc-tools PKCS #11 module The following is a guide to assist in setting up Linux Mint to access CAC-enabled DoD websites. US Department of Defense (DoD) now limits access to many of its websites to be via a smart Common Access Card (CAC) authenticated with a Personal Identification Number (PIN).
